Exercise
As dogs age, their power levels and metabolic rates decrease. Nonetheless, that does not mean they must stop working out completely! Normal activity and socializing are necessary for the overall wellness of a senior pet.

If you have a senior pet, it is essential to locate low-impact exercise that is easy on their joints. As an example, swimming can be a terrific form of exercise due to the fact that it decreases stress on their muscle mass and joints. It's additionally a great concept to have your animal begin each workout with a short walk around the backyard or do some light playtime to heat up their muscles and decrease their threat of injury.

Another means to keep your senior pet sensation comfortable is to check their urination and bowel movements. Occasionally these changes can signify a medical issue that needs to be resolved. Speak with your veterinarian for advice.

Health care
Aging canines commonly come across health issue as they age. While they are a regular part of the aging procedure, very early detection and treatment can considerably enhance your family pet's comfort level.

Regular blood screenings, geriatric bloodwork and pee analysis can capture a range of problems such as anemia and iron shortages, kidney disease, thyroid disorder and various other illnesses that can be extra typical in senior family pets.

If your canine appears much more tight, has difficulty leaping or playing and loses interest in food, talk to your veterinarian as these could be signs of discomfort, arthritis or various other health problems. A change in hunger or weight gain may likewise indicate an issue, like diabetes or cardiovascular disease.
